The Herschell Factory Museum in North Tonawanda announces it will be open President's Day week, Feb. 15-19, with STEM activities offered each day for children to learn about and create. 

STEM activities will feature manufacturing a building out of Lincoln Logs; engineering; making a magnetic train track; cleaning pennies and then making them turn green; building a moving carrousel horse; and the making of "snow."

Regular admission prices apply: Cost is $6 for adults and $3 for children ages 2-16 (kids under 2 are admitted free).
